4.5GW/10.24GWh!江西首批省级独立储能试点示范项目清单发布
Core Viewpoint - The Jiangxi Provincial Energy Bureau has issued a notification regarding the first batch of provincial-level independent energy storage pilot demonstration projects, with a total scale of 4.5 GW / 10.24 GWh, primarily utilizing lithium iron phosphate technology [2][6]. Project Overview - The total scale of the projects is 4.5 GW / 10.24 GWh, with various technologies including lithium iron phosphate, electrochemical storage combined with flywheel storage, electrochemical storage combined with supercapacitor technology, and compressed air storage technology [2]. - Major project owners include Jiangxi Zhongke Yieneng, Datang, and Ronghe Yuanshu, with respective capacities of 300 MW / 1800 MWh, 550 MW / 1200 MWh, and 400 MW / 800 MWh [3]. - Key project locations are in Yichun, Jiujiang, and Ganzhou, with capacities of 1000 MW / 3120 MWh, 700 MW / 1400 MWh, and 700 MW / 1366 MWh respectively [3]. Project Timeline and Requirements - All pilot demonstration projects are required to be completed and connected to the grid by June 30, 2026, with the possibility of extension for compressed air storage projects based on actual construction conditions [3][6]. Responsibilities and Management - Local electricity industry authorities are tasked with managing the pilot demonstration projects, ensuring alignment with the provincial energy development plan, and optimizing project layouts to avoid over-concentration or disorderly dispersion [7][8]. - Project units must adhere to safety management protocols, conduct risk assessments, and ensure compliance with local regulations [8][9]. - Grid companies are responsible for providing access services and ensuring that the construction of supporting transmission projects aligns with the progress of the pilot projects [9][10].

储能时长最长 新疆一液流新型储能电站并网发电
news flash· 2025-05-28 09:21
5月28日,在新疆昌吉州吉木萨尔县,吉木萨尔20万千瓦/100万千瓦时全钒液流新型储能项目并网发 电。其中,新型储能电站的储能时长达到5小时,是新疆储能时间最长的液流新型储能电站,单次最大 能储存100万度电,大约能满足390户三口之家的一年用电需求。(央视新闻) ...

每天可储80万度电!这个大型锂钠混合储能站投产
Xin Hua She· 2025-05-26 09:52
Core Insights - The Baocai Energy Storage Station, a national pilot project, has been launched in Yunnan Province, featuring a large lithium-sodium hybrid energy storage system with a daily storage capacity of 800,000 kWh [1][2] Group 1: Project Overview - The Baocai Energy Storage Station occupies approximately 50 acres, with a maximum instantaneous output capacity of 200 MW and a total storage capacity of 400 MWh [2] - The station can adjust 1.6 million kWh of electricity daily and 584 million kWh annually, which is equivalent to the annual electricity consumption of about 270,000 households [2] Group 2: Technological Advancements - The energy storage station utilizes advanced sodium-ion battery technology, which has a response speed six times faster than existing sodium-ion batteries [5] - The integration of lithium and sodium battery storage advantages aims to expand the application scenarios for sodium-ion battery storage in China [5] Group 3: Industry Context - Yunnan Province has a high proportion of renewable energy, with installed capacity exceeding 60 million kW and a penetration rate close to 70% in the power system [5] - The Baocai Energy Storage Station is designed to support over 30 wind and solar power plants in Yunnan, enhancing the stability of renewable energy integration into the grid [5]

一季度新增装机规模历史性下降 新型储能高速增长按下了“暂停键”
今年一季度,国内新型储能新增装机出现历史性下滑,引发行业广泛关注。中关村储能产业技术联盟公 布的数据显示,一季度新增投运装机规模为5.03GW/11.79GWh,同比下降1.5%和5.5%,这是该联盟自 2022年公开统计以来首次出现负增长。 尽管多家头部储能企业反映"531"抢装潮导致订单激增,但一季度装机数据仍出现下滑。装机数据和市 场感受缘何错位?新增装机首次下滑,是否意味着新型储能产业高速增长态势将告一段落? 市场弥漫观望情绪 在构建新型电力系统背景下,我国新型储能装机实现快速发展,连续3年新增和累计装机规模增速均超 过100%。 新增装机陡然下滑,始料未及。今年2月9日,国家发改委、国家能源局联合发布《关于深化新能源上网 电价市场化改革促进新能源高质量发展的通知》(以下简称"136号文"),明确要求"不得将配置储能作为 新建新能源项目核准、并网、上网等的前置条件"。该政策直接叫停了实施多年的新能源强制配储政 策,维持多年的政策驱动发展模式发生根本改变。 储能企业人士向《中国能源报》记者坦言,短期新型储能面临较大压力。"随着新能源配储政策调整, 项目方可能消减储能配套投资。从近期市场数据看,储能项目招 ...
今年前四月内蒙古能源经济稳中向好 能源工业增加值增长5.0%
Xin Hua Cai Jing· 2025-05-22 04:54
三是能源产品产量保持平稳。1-4月,内蒙古规上工业原煤产量4.28亿吨,同比增长0.6%;发电量2797 亿千瓦时,同比增长5.1%,其中新能源发电量1005亿千瓦时,增长43%,占全区发电量的35.9%,同比 提高9.6个百分点;外送电量1105亿千瓦时,同比增长7.9%,其中外送新能源电量350亿千瓦时,增长 63%;原油产量109.4万吨,同比增长2.2%;天然气产量114.7亿立方米,同比基本持平。 四是能源重点工作取得实效。内蒙古大力推进新能源"沙戈荒"外送基地建设,两个基地配套煤电项目获 得核准。新增自用煤电规模已分解至5个盟市,其中3个自用煤电项目已完成选址,预计年底前取得核 准。1-4月,内蒙古新增新能源装机325万千瓦,累计装机达到1.38亿千瓦,占电力总装机的51.2%,同 比提高6.4个百分点;新型储能新增装机53万千瓦,累计建成装机达到1085.7万千瓦;绿氢产量2413吨, 已达到2024年全年产量的87%。(侯倩) (文章来源:新华财经) 据内蒙古自治区能源局消息,今年1-4月,内蒙古能源重大项目延续一季度较快增长态势,能源产品稳 产稳供,全区能源经济稳中向好。 一是能源贡献作用持 ...
